Democrats’ Dilemma: Defending Institutions or Focusing on Daily Life Threats in Resisting Elon Musk’s Influence

Democrats’ Dilemma: Resisting Musk’s Assault on Governance

The Democrats face a perplexing choice as they seek to counter Elon Musk’s unprecedented influence over the federal government. They must decide between defending the systemic integrity of government or emphasizing the tangible threats posed to Americans’ daily lives.

Defense of Democratic Norms

One approach entails upholding the principles of checks and balances, democratic norms, and institutional safeguards. Democrats argue the necessity of foreign aid, federal spending, and a robust bureaucracy to ensure the smooth functioning of the government.

However, this approach may resonate primarily with the party’s existing base, composed largely of college-educated, liberal Americans. The risk is that it fails to appeal to less engaged, less educated, or less partisan voters.

Threats to Personal Security

An alternative strategy focuses on the tangible dangers Musk’s actions pose to Americans’ personal information, financial security, and access to essential benefits. The argument emphasizes Musk’s encroachment into agencies such as the Social Security Administration, Medicare, and Medicaid.

This approach has the potential to galvanize a broader audience, including those who may be less concerned with abstract democratic principles. Recent polling indicates public wariness about Musk’s role in government, particularly concerning his access to sensitive data.

Fork in the Road

Democrats must decide which path to prioritize. The choice hinges on the party’s goals of preserving the integrity of democratic institutions while also addressing the practical concerns of everyday Americans.

Focus on Democratic Norms

The emphasis on defending democratic norms focuses attention on the potential constitutional crisis that Musk’s actions create. Democrats stress the importance of adhering to the rule of law and safeguarding the balance of power between the branches of government.

However, this messaging may be less effective in reaching a broad audience, particularly those who voted for Trump seeking change from the status quo. The perception that Democrats are defending an establishment that voters rejected could limit the impact of this approach.

Focus on Personal Threats

The emphasis on personal threats highlights the real risks that Musk’s actions pose to Americans’ livelihoods and personal security. Democrats argue that Musk’s access to sensitive information and his efforts to dismantle agencies like the CFPB could have devastating consequences for individuals and families.

This messaging has the potential to appeal to a wider range of voters, regardless of their political leanings. By presenting Musk as a threat to the financial well-being and personal safety of all Americans, Democrats may be able to galvanize support for their resistance efforts.

Post-Election Identity Crisis

The debate over which approach to adopt reflects a broader identity crisis within the Democratic Party. The party grapples with how to reconcile its commitment to democratic principles with the need to connect with voters who rejected the status quo in favor of Trump’s populist agenda.
